Transaction 86f68a306b220362ec2ad909d3cbf2a480c7797b7bfbd8b2b743420cf0e48157
1 Input
1 Output
-
86f68a306b220362ec2ad909d3cbf2a480c7797b7bfbd8b2b743420cf0e48157:0
- value
- 12228156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a96d3588d4391ddcf527ae3d246cace0e1406bf OP_EQUAL
- address
- 3QY1Y3bupGgq87uBauMsSZpu59cLdawkMh